Hey everyone. I've been mining bitcoins in BTCguild for little over a month, with my laptop and my desktop. Even though the results were good, the minimum payout of BTCguilt is 0.01 BTC, which I find too darned high!

I've accumulated about 0.078 bitcoin so far and I still have a long way to go, before I can use that bitcoin for gambling on sites like Bitzino.

I'd like to know if there are alternative pools/methods to mine bitcoin so that I can get small payouts every day or every week.

Small amount transactions is possible, but processed last without commission.
You may wait too small payments for weeks/months.
0.01 ($1 current price) is a good minimum.

Small payouts aren't really good for you.  You could end up paying a higher transaction fee then the amount of BTC you're trying to send.

My minimum payout is 1 BTC on each pool I use.
